Transaction 34d87ca90234abb7d8aedfd53a36b76fabd37fb1151861b67f6eb6403c951b00
1 Input
1 Output
-
34d87ca90234abb7d8aedfd53a36b76fabd37fb1151861b67f6eb6403c951b00:0
- value
- 99588834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a742772038530c6b64a38773253948e7b8bf71e5 OP_EQUAL
- address
- 3GwQPfvWswe87yJyQKT9xCmRJLofvYcqv1